Arnold Schwarzenegger’s new action-comedy series ‘FUBAR’ coming to Netflix in May

Arnold Schwarzenegger is returning to the small screen for the first time in his career with the upcoming action-comedy series ‘FUBAR’, which will premiere on Netflix on May 25. Created by Nick Santora, the show is described as a CIA spy comedy mixed with heart-stopping action, and will follow the story of a father and daughter who discover that their entire relationship is built on a lie, and that they are each CIA operatives. The eight-episode series will depict family dynamics with humor, action and spies.

Arnold Schwarzenegger, the former California governor, bodybuilder, and all-around action icon, will play a lead role in the show, which also stars Monica Barbaro, Jay Baruchel, Fortune Feimster, Milan Carter, Travis Van Winkle, Gabriel Luna, Andy Buckley, Aparna Brielle, Barbara Eve Harris, and Fabiana Udenio. Schwarzenegger is also an executive producer for the series, alongside Santora.

The show’s title, FUBAR, is an acronym for “fucked up beyond all repair,” though in the show it could mean something different, such as “Fun Ultimate Badass Arnold Ruckus.” The show’s announcement teaser shows Arnold doing very Arnold things like lighting a cigar, firing a gun, and driving a car very fast, while also showcasing the show’s humor with a slap to the groin.

Schwarzenegger said in a press release that wherever he goes, people ask him when he’s going to do another big action comedy like True Lies, and that he’s excited to be bringing that to audiences with FUBAR. He promised the show would “kick your ass and make you laugh, and not just for two hours. You get a whole season.” Unfortunately, he hasn’t yet revealed how many episodes the season will have.

FUBAR marks Schwarzenegger’s return to scripted television and his first TV series, and he expressed his enthusiasm for the project in the press release. The show’s creator, Santora, said he was inspired by how Schwarzenegger could be funny while still kicking ass and wanted to create a hysterical, CIA-spy comedy mixed with heart-stopping action. The series was created with Skydance Television.
